Transaction 4259ad3ab44f206d2938f5c3a7dc4042006aa3760df78dde860f5787841230af
1 Input
2 Outputs
- 4259ad3ab44f206d2938f5c3a7dc4042006aa3760df78dde860f5787841230af:0
- 4259ad3ab44f206d2938f5c3a7dc4042006aa3760df78dde860f5787841230af:1
value 32435
address 3KjHA2iNieEDGxenPxr2zfxqiuKd2ta98g
value 33177
address 1CxJwCSo6PMTdSg4dcgUutboE5rgkvqy9n